
United States Air Force Academy – Colorado Springs, CO
Sustainable Infrastructure Assessments (SIAs)
SynEnergy team collected energy consumption data and assessed facilities using solution-based audit strategies to perform Level 1-3 audit evaluations to identify potential Energy Conservation Opportunities (ECOs), Water Conservation Opportunities (WCOs), and Investment Grade Projects (IGPs). High-performance sustainable building (HPSB) assessments were concurrently conducted.

US Department of Health & Human Services
Indian Health Center – Cherokee, NC — ASHRAE level 3 Investment Grade Energy Audit
SynEnergy was selected as the energy engineering consulting firm to conduct energy analyses (ASHRAE level 3) for the Indian Health Center in Cherokee, NC. The audit included lowering their energy consumption, peak demand, operations and maintenance cost, and increasing building occupancy comfort.

Department of Energy Renewable Energy Feasibility Study
Oneida Tribe of Indians of Wisconsin
SynEnergy conducted an initial renewable energy feasibility study in order to assist the Oneida Nation with the identification of appropriate facilities for incorporation of renewable energy technologies. Technologies that were analyzed included – PV, Biomass, Wind, Solar Thermal and District Heating/Cooling.
